[QUOTE="TimeFlipper, post: 157297, member: 6456"] There is the Grandfather Paradox where a guy goes back in time and kills his Grandfather, before the conception of his mother or father.. If the guy did kill his Grandfather in that manner, then there is no way he could go forward in time to his previous life because one of his parents is dead and therefore the guy does not exist...:confused: To get around that Grandfather paradox, there is a theory that says when the guy goes back in time to kill his Grandfather, he automatically goes into an "alternative universe" which is identical to this universe except that changes can be made in it which does not affect this universe of ours... So, the guy can pop back in time to that alternative universe and kill his Grandfather before either his mum or dad have been conceived, and then return forward to this universe where his Grandad is still alive and so are his parents, and the guy still exists :cool: The theory of the Alternative Universe means that when ever we go back in time, the "Time Law" will automatically send you to another (alternative) universe where changes in that universe are allowed, and then when you travel forward in time, you automatically get back to this universe where nothing has changed.. If you went forward in time the "Time Law" would still exist and you would still enter an alternative universe, just like in the Grandfather Paradox, But of course its just a theory :) [/QUOTE]
